Dear Naresh,

I wanted to say that about buying calls at R1 and puts at S1 as its strangle. Buy calls at S1 and puts at R1.

Follow the strategy stated below:

If Nifty opens with gap up and remain above 20pts till 10:30AM - 10:45 AM buy calls at S1 with SL 20-30% from your buy price. Book profit if your target is achieved or buy puts at R1 around 3:00 PM-3:15 PM and hold call with a trailing SL of say 10%.

If Nifty opens with gap down and remain below 20pts till 10:30AM - 10:45 AM buy puts at R1 with SL 20-30% from your buy price. Book profit if your target is achieved or buy calls at R1 around 3:00 PM-3:15 PM and and hold put with a trailing SL of say 10%.

Vary calls and puts nos. according to the trend.

So, as per current strategy today we should have bought puts at R1 and should be holding it with trailing SL=10% max.

I hope this helps.
